Linear Alkyl Benzene Companies

Linear Alkyl Benzene (LAB) companies specialize in the production of LAB, a key ingredient in the manufacturing of biodegradable detergents. These companies employ advanced chemical processes to synthesize LAB from linear paraffins and benzene. LAB serves as a crucial component in the detergent industry, ensuring effective and environmentally friendly cleaning solutions.

Market Landscape and Strategies:




  • Market Domination: Established players like ExxonMobil, Shell, Chevron Phillips Chemical, and BASF hold significant market shares, leveraging economies of scale and brand recognition. Their strategies involve vertical integration, operational efficiency enhancements, and long-term supply contracts.


  • Regional Focus: Emerging economies in Asia-Pacific, particularly China and India, exhibit booming demand for LAB due to the burgeoning middle class and rising disposable incomes. Players like China National Petroleum Corporation (CNPC) and Reliance Industries are capitalizing on this, expanding production capacities in the region.


  • Innovation: Sustainability concerns are pushing manufacturers towards bio-based LAB alternatives made from renewable resources like coconut oil. Companies like Stepan Company and Kao Corporation are actively investing in bio-LAB technologies to gain a competitive edge and cater to environmentally conscious consumers.


  • Diversification: Some players are exploring new application areas for LAB beyond traditional ones. For instance, utilizing LAB derivatives in personal care products, agrochemicals, and oilfield applications opens up untapped growth potential.


Factors Influencing Market Share:




  • Production Capacity and Cost: Access to raw materials, plant efficiency, and cost-effective production processes significantly impact a player's competitiveness. Large-scale producers enjoy cost advantages, while smaller companies may focus on niche markets or differentiated products.


  • Technological Prowess: Continuous innovation in LAB production, particularly bio-based alternatives and eco-friendly processes, can attract new customers and secure market share. Companies with strong R&D capabilities hold an edge.


  • Regulatory Environment: Stringent environmental regulations in Europe and North America favor bio-based LAB and restrict traditional LAB production. Adapting to these regulations is crucial for market share retention.


  • Distribution Network and Customer Relationships: Robust distribution networks and strong relationships with key customers in diverse industries enhance market reach and brand loyalty.

The Linear Alkyl Benzene market segmentation, based on application, can be segmented across linear alkylbenzene sulfonates and non-surfactant applications. The linear alkylbenzene sulfonates (LAS) segment held the majority share in 2022 contribution to around ~74%-77% in respect to the linear alkyl benzene market revenue. Heavy-duty laundry liquids, laundry powders, light-duty washing powders, and household cleaners are included within LAS. For instance, according to some studies, a lower cost of laundry powders compared to laundry liquids will account for a significant share of the segmental growth of the linear alkyl benzene market. Additionally, LAS can be quickly processed in powdered form and does not affect enzyme stability.

For instance, India Linear Alkyl Benzene market is expected to contribute a wider share to the Asia Pacific market. Factors such as the growing demand of consumers are giving rise to personal care products among the general population, which will fuel the growth of the linear alkyl benzene market in India. According to the Chemical and Petrochemical Manufacturers Association (CPMA), the Indian annual production of LAB was about 550 kilotons in FY2020-21. According to the Department of Chemicals and Petrochemicals (India), the production volume of synthetic detergent will increase from 714.68 kilotons in 2020 to 736.44 kilotons in 2021.

Linear Alkyl Benzene Industry Developments


August 2022: CEPSA announced that they supplied their first batch of NextLAB (Linear alkyl Benzene) to Unilever for linear alkylbenzene sulphonate (LAS)-based surfactant manufacturing. NextLab is the first linear alkylbenzene (LAB) that will be a renewable and biodegradable version to the traditional LAB.


June 2020: Studies have indicated that after the launch of the Swachh Bharat Mission in India, the market of alkyl benzene in the country is expected to proliferate due to the increased production of soaps, detergents, cleansing agents, and surface cleaners.


December 2018: DNOC and CEPSA agreed to develop a Linear Alkyl Benzene (LAB) plant in the Ruwais Derivates Park. In the new plant, the companies announced they were investing more than USD 45 billion and would have a production capacity of USD 225,000 metric tons per annum.
